Activities and Updates at the State Time and Frequency Standard of Russia
Abstract
As it was announced, a campaign on the State Time and Frequency Standard modernization is under realization. A new prototype of the primary Cs fountain standard with an uncertainty of 3x10(-15) is under metrological investigation, which is expected to be finished at the end of 2009. For today, we have two new ensembles each of four H-masers of type of CH1-75A with individual cavity auto-tuning systems. The whole instrumentation set includes distribution amplifiers, a frequency and time measuring system, and a real-time time scale generation and distributing system. All these instruments are installed in thermally and humidity controlled chambers. Typical temperature and relative humidity variations are well below 0.1 degrees C and approximately 1% respectively. As a result, the frequency stability of the H-masers on a 1-day basis is about few parts in 10(16). The new remote clock comparison system consists of several multichannel dual-frequency GLONASS/GPS TTS-3 receivers. All receivers have been differentially calibrated relative to a portable receiver as part of a calibration campaign arranged by the BIPM. A TWSTFT station is under construction in VNIIFTRI. The closest main goal is to arrange a time link to PTB and NICT via the IS-4 satellite. The same instrumentation set (four H-masers, a frequency and time measuring system, and time transfer equipment) will be installed in secondary laboratories in Novosibirsk, Irkutsk, Khabarovsk, and Petropavlovsk Kamchatsky.
